Orange Rice Medley
Prep: 15 min Cook: 20 min Servings: 8by Robyn Savoie269 recipes>This is a lovely, slightly sweet side dish. It looks so pretty with the harvest colors of chopped green and red peppers and orange slices tucked in with the rice. Ingredients
- 1/2 Cup Onion, Diced
- 1/2 Cup Green Bell Pepper, Diced
- 1/2 Cup Red Bell Pepper, Diced
- 2 Tbsp. Olive Oil
- 1 Cup Uncooked Long Grain Rice
- 1 1/2 Cups Reduced Sodium Chicken Broth
- 1/2 Cup Orange Juice
- 1/4 Tsp. Salt
- 1 Dash Black Pepper
- 11 Oz. Can Mandarin Oranges, Drained and Coarsely Chopped
Directions
- In a saucepan over medium heat, saute onion and peppers in oil until tender. Add rice; stir until lightly browned.
- Add broth, orange juice, salt and pepper; b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 15-20 minutes or until liquid is absorbed. Stir in oranges.
- Note: This is great served with Southwestern Pork Chops.
- Tip: Try substituting chopped pineapple chunks and replace the orange juice with pineapple juice. It's great this way too!
